""Old Times In The Colonies"" is a historical book written by Charles Carleton Coffin that explores the daily life, customs and traditions of the American colonies during the 17th and 18th centuries. The author provides an in-depth analysis of the social, economic and political aspects of the colonies, including their origins, development and eventual independence from British rule. Coffin also delves into the conflicts and struggles that arose during this time period, such as the Salem Witch Trials, the French and Indian War, and the American Revolution.
